Iowa State women’s basketball coach Bill Fennelly received some good news late Thursday night. 

Kylie Feuerbach, a class of 2020 prospect from Sycamore High School in Sycamore, Illinois, announced on Twitter Thursday that she was committing to play for Iowa State. Feuerbach is a 6-foot tall wing player, according to MaxPreps. 

“I want to thank coach Fennelly and the entire women’s basketball program for this amazing opportunity,” Feuerbach said in her tweet. “It’s an honor to play for the same school my grandpa played at.”

Feuerbach’s grandfather, the late Dr. Orlyn Feuerbach, played basketball for the Cyclones from 1943-1945 and is in the Iowa State University Basketball Hall of Fame.

Feuerbach is Iowa State’s second commit in the 2020 class.
